Annotation: World of Work books feature easy-to-read text that offers much-needed information and resources for getting that job.

The fishing industry -- one of the oldest sources for jobs around -- is a $25 billion business, employing nearly 200,000 Americans as commercial fishermen. Since North Americans are eating more seafood than ever before, this book is perfect for reluctant readers with a love of the outdoors who may not be interested in an office job. Written in easy-to-understand language, the book provides a thorough look at everything from being a captain of an offshore fishing vessel to the exciting job of a fishing conservationist at a state park. Discussion of salary and working conditions is included.
